The 2025 Longines Global Champions Tour (LGCT) and GCL season launched in style at the prestigious Al Shaqab in Doha, setting the stage for another thrilling year of world-class show jumping. The season opener will bring together elite riders competing for individual glory in the LGCT Championship, passionate fans, and a highly competitive GCL team lineup.



The opening press conference highlighted the significance of Al Shaqab as the ideal venue to launch the 2025 season, as well as hearing from top riders in the sport such as Edwina Tops-Alexander and Julien Anquetin. With its state-of-the-art facilities and deep-rooted equestrian culture, the Qatari capital provided a fitting backdrop for what promises to be a landmark year for the sport.

“Hosting the Longines Global Champions Tour at Al Shaqab presents a remarkable opportunity to strengthen Qatar’s standing in the global equestrian scene. At Al Shaqab, we are committed to delivering the highest standards of organisation and excellence, ensuring a competition experience that reflects Qatar’s equestrian prestige, balancing modernity with deep-rooted traditions,” said Mr. Mohammed Jaber Al-Khayarin, Event Director, reflecting on the unique atmosphere and top-tier competition expected throughout the weekend.

The visionary behind the Longines Global Champions Tour, Mr. Jan Tops, Founder and President said: “We are always pleased to return to Al Shaqab, a venue we have been visiting since 2008. Over the years, both the country and this event have grown a lot, improving year after year, and we are incredibly proud to be here. This is the perfect event and location to have as the start of the 2025 season and gives the riders an opportunity to really get ready for the year ahead – we have just announced that the tour this year returns to the likes of Vienna and New York. We look forward to a big season ahead.”

Mr. Marco Danese, Sports Director of the Longines Global Champions Tour and GCL, highlighted the strong line up and talked about the new schedule: “Our top priority is always the welfare of the horses. With the GCL now taking place on Day 1 at most events this season, riders have better opportunities for preparation and recovery of their horses. This schedule also creates a more balanced competition flow, allowing for a strategic approach between the GCL and the Longines Global Champions Tour Grand Prix.”

The second half of the press conference welcomed Monaco Comets powered by Iron Dames, a brand-new team joining the 17-team grid of GCL in 2025. With high expectations and a bold vision, the Comets are set to bring fresh energy to the championship.

Deborah Mayer, Monaco Comets powered by Iron Dames Team Owner and Manager smiled: “It is an honour to have two teams competing in the 2025 GCL circuit, it is a real pleasure to welcome the talented and experienced riders on the new team and we are looking forward to this beautiful journey together. We are here to stay for the long time.”

“To be a part of this is a huge honour there are so many incredible women part of this project, we are going to do the best we can this season. The Cannes Stars set an incredible example last year worldwide.” Edwina Tops-Alexander said reflecting on their excitement to be part of the action.

Adding to the excitement, the official Doha 2025 Riders List has been unveiled, revealing a stellar lineup poised to battle for early-season supremacy. Among them are eight of the top 10 riders from the 2024 LGCT Championship final standings, including Christian Kukuk, Andreas Schou, and Edwina Tops-Alexander. Reigning GCL Champions and Doha 2024 winners, Cannes Stars powered by Iron Dames, are ready to defend their title with a formidable trio—Sophie Hinners, Janne Friederike Meyer-Zimmermann, and Sanne Thijssen—leading their charge.

They will go head-to-head with some of the biggest names in the sport, including Pieter Devos and Niels Bruynseels, Zascha Nygaard Lill, Philipp Weishaupt, and the formidable Madrid In Motion trio of Eduardo Alvarez Aznar, Maikel van der Vleuten, and Kim Emmen.
Valkenswaard United boasts the legendary Marcus Ehning, while the Longines Arena is set to witness Denis Lynch and Scott Brash bring their wealth of experience to the fight for glory.
